GRAND THEFT AUTO 6 HAS BEEN DELAYED TO MAY 2026, AND IT COULD CAUSE A HUGE DROP IN ANTICIPATED SPENDING IN THE GAMES INDUSTRY, RISING TO MORE THAN $2.5 BILLION DOLLARS 13:03, 21 May 2025 GTA


6 was recently delayed to May 2026, meaning we're now around a year away from the most anticipated game in history. While it had been tipped to 'save' the video games


industry, the cost of its delay could be colossal for the video game industry, according to a new report from Ampere Analysis (via Gamespot). With Grand Theft Auto 6 reportedly having been


in development for years, publishers had been keeping release dates close to their chest until they knew what Rockstar was planning. While those same rivals will breathe a sigh of relief for


their 2025 plans, the fallout of the delay could have huge ramifications. GTA 6 DELAY MAY HAVE COST VIDEO GAME INDUSTRY $2.7 BILLION Ampere's data suggests that Grand Theft Auto 6


being nudged to 2026 would mean a big drop in console sales for casual games eager to check out Rockstar's epic, with Sony reportedly nabbing the marketing rights to the huge title.


Article continues below Ampere dubbed 2025's Holiday period a "vacuum" without GTA 6, and suggested that Nintendo could be poised to capitalise with its Switch 2 launching in


June and likely gaining momentum until the end of the year. Given GTA 6 is expected to rack up billions in revenue when it does learn, the hope will be that it'll raise the profile of


the games industry again, which has been through thousands of layoffs in recent years following a spike in popularity during the COVID pandemic. Ampere suggests the industry will grow by


around 1% in 2025, but that's likely to hit 2.2% in 2026 thanks to GTA 6. The company's Piers Harding-Rolls said a lack of new monetisation strategies or meaningful tech advances


means the industry is "looking for pockets of growth to exploit and to build content more efficiently and at lower cost." At the time of the delay, Rockstar's statement said:


"We are very sorry this is later than you expected." "The interest and excitement surrounding a new Grand Theft Auto has been truly humbling for our entire team. We want to


thank you for your support and your patience as we work to finish the game." Article continues below "With every game we have released, the goal has always been to try and exceed


your expectations, and Grand Theft Auto VI is no exception. We hope you understand that we need this extra time to deliver at the level of quality you expect and deserve." For more on
